Have you forgotten the gutters again?
Because the weather turns cold and wet, blocked gutters happen more often this time of year. Leaves fall. Moss drops from the roof. Water builds up. And, before long, you’ve got a waterfall running over the edge and onto your path. Most people don’t notice until it’s raining sideways and they’re wondering why the downpipe isn’t doing anything.
Therefore, clearing the gutters before Christmas is one of the easiest wins for a tidy-looking home. It prevents overflow. It stops damp patches forming. And it means no one has to see you rushing out mid-visit with a ladder and a coat over your pyjamas.

Render and walls that might need a little help
Some homes start to show green or red staining on the render at this time of year. The wind brings moisture. The shade stretches across the garden earlier. And that organic growth finds a cosy place to settle. Although many homeowners only notice it when the days get shorter, it does build quietly all year.
Now, because this staining can spoil the look of your home, our SoftWash render cleaning is a strong option before family gatherings. The treatment is gentle. It’s safe for K-Rend, painted render and monocouche. And it gives a noticeable lift that lasts long after Christmas is over.
Paths and patios that don’t need to embarrass you
If you’re anything like most homeowners, the patio is where you store things “temporarily” during the year. Plant pots. Toys. Garden chairs. Then Christmas arrives. Suddenly, everyone is parking on the drive, walking around the side gate or stepping over the slabs to reach the back door. And, suddenly, that green surface algae becomes the main attraction.
A quick clean with hot water and a SoftWash treatment makes a huge difference. It brightens everything. And it keeps things safer, as winter algae can be surprisingly slippery.
